Confi guration Screen #40 - Reversing Valve

Active During Heat/Cool

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Rev. Valve Active

For: Heat

Use < Or > To Change

Select Heat if your Heat Pump unit activates its Reversing Valve dur-
ing Heating operation. Select Cool if your Heat Pump unit activates its
Reversing Valve during Cooling operation. Default is Heat.

Confi guration Screen #41 - Emergency

Shutdown Input

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Emergency Shutdown

Input: NO

Use < Or > To Change

Select YES if a Smoke Detector/Firestat or other Emergency Shutdown
input is connected to the binary input. If the Emergency Shutdown input
is active, the Supply Fan, Heating and Cooling Relay Outputs will be
disabled. Default is NO.

Confi guration Screen #42 - Return Air Bypass

Control

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Return Air Bypass

Control: NO

Use < Or > To Change

Select YES if your HVAC unit requires Return Air Bypass Control for
Dehumidifi cation Reheat. Default is NO.

Confi guration Screen #43 - Broadcast OA Temp

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Broadcast Outdoor

Temperature: NO

Use < Or > To Change

The VCM-X can broadcast its Outdoor Air Temperature Reading to
other HVAC units if they are not equipped with their own Outdoor Air
Temperature sensors. A network communications device is needed
in order for this feature to operate. Select YES to Broadcast Outdoor
Temperature. Default is NO.

Confi guration Screen #44 - Broadcast OA Humidity

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Broadcast Outdoor

Humidity: NO

Use < Or > To Change

The VCM-X can broadcast its Outdoor Air Humidity reading to other
HVAC units if they are not equipped with their own Outdoor Air Hu-
midity sensors. A network communications device is required in order
for this feature to operate. Select YES to Broadcast Outdoor Humidity.
Default is NO.

Confi guration Screen #45 - Broadcast Supply

Temperature

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Broadcast Supply

Temperature: YES

Use < Or > To Change

This broadcast sends the VCM-X’s Supply Air Temperature to all con-
trollers on its local loop. This broadcast needs to be confi gured on a VAV
or Zoning System using the VCM-X with Orion VAV/Zone Controllers.
A network communications device is required in order for this feature to
operate. Select YES to Broadcast Supply Temperature. Default is YES.

Confi guration Screen #46 - Broadcast Status

Fan & Heat

VCM-X Cnfg ID 59

Broadcast Status

Fan & Heat: NO

Use < Or > To Change

This broadcast sends the VCM-X’s Supply Fan and Heating Status to
all controllers on its local loop. This broadcast needs to be confi gured
on a VAV or Zoning System using the VCM-X with Orion VAV/Zone
Controllers. A network communications device is required in order for
this feature to operate. Select YES to Broadcast Status Fan & Heat.
Default is NO.
